WILLIAMS v. BELGRADE STATE BANK

No. 21505.

953 S.W.2d 187 (1997)

Ellen WILLIAMS, Plaintiff-Appellant, v. BELGRADE STATE BANK, Defendant-Respondent.

Missouri Court of Appeals, Southern District, Division One.

October 16, 1997.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Richard B. Dempsey, Washington, for Plaintiff-Appellant.

Michael W. Silvey, Schnapp, Fulton, Fall, McNamara & Silvey, L.L.C., Fredericktown, for Defendant-Respondent.

Before GARRISON, P.J., and PREWITT and CROW, JJ.


PREWITT, Judge.

The trial court dismissed each count of Plaintiff's three-count petition for failure to state a claim for which relief can be granted. Plaintiff appeals, presenting three "points relied on," each directed to the dismissal of a specific count.
